The Power of Clay: 
A Renee So inspired pottery workshop 

Slow down and learn the mindful art of hand-building pots inspired by Commodities: Sculpture and Ceramics by Renee So.

You’ll go on an exclusive tour of the exhibition where Curator Jane Simpkiss will highlight So’s most playful works, followed by a sketching session in the exhibition to find inspiration for your vase, vessel or plant pot.

You’ll then be taught how to pinch, coil, slab and sculpt clay into a form of your own design by our clay expert Jon, the Flying Potter, from Eastnor Pottery.

At the end of the course, you can take your pottery masterpiece home to airdry and paint, or you can choose to have them fired for an extra fee payable on the day.

No previous experience of working with clay is necessary as you’ll be given all the tools, materials and guidance on the day.
